Here's Wishing You By Franklin Price 8/1/2015 Here's wishing you an august August A very tepid time of year The last full month of Summer heat The fall is coming give a cheer We haven't really liked the heat Pushed one hundred very hot Soon be complaining of the cold When snow and ice is what we've got Not many days when we are happy Of the weather we complain Summer heat and dryness now Praying for a little rain When it rains and wet days come We complain it rains too much Want just enough to make lawns green And grow our veggies just a touch Be glad that you can still complain Be happy with the things you've got Be thankful that you're still alive Whether it be cold or hot
